Best Inglewood Private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 7 private elementary schools serving 873 students in Inglewood, CA.
The top-ranked private elementary school in Inglewood, CA is Slauson Learning Center.
The average acceptance rate is 98%, which is higher than the California private elementary school average acceptance rate of 81%.
29% of private elementary schools in Inglewood, CA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ic and Brethren).
